2019 LD2: A very interesting orbit-hopping comet

Prior to Comet 2019 LD2, discovered last year, astronomers had never witnessed a comet in the process of orbiting from being between Jupiter and Neptune to orbiting inside Jupiter’s orbit. Field geology at Mars’ equator points to ancient megaflood

Floods of unimaginable magnitude once washed through Gale Crater on Mars’ equator around 4 billion years ago—a finding that hints at the possibility that life may have existed there, according to data collected by NASA’s Curiosity rover and analyzed in joint project by scientists from Jackson State University, Cornell University, the Jet Propulsion Laboratory and the University of Hawaii. Astronomers measure a change in orbit for infamous asteroid Apophis

Astronomers in Hawaii have detected the Yarkovsky effect – a minuscule push imparted by sunlight – for asteroid Apophis. The effect is particularly important for Apophis, because it relates to the possibility of an Earth impact in 2068. A new theory to explain how the dunes on Titan formed

A trio of researchers with the University of Hawaii has developed a new theory to explain how the dunes on Saturn’s largest moon, Titan, may have formed. In their paper published in the journal Science Advances, Matthew Abplanalp, Robert Frigge and Ralf Kaiser suggest that rather than forming from rainfall, the dunes have formed on the moon’s surface.
